Job Summary

 

Health Information Technology and Services at University of Michigan Health is looking for a Clinical Pharmacist specializing in Pharmacy Informatics to join our Pharmacy Informatics & Technology team. This position will primarily support Epic Willow Ambulatory. You will report to the Manager of Outpatient Pharmacy Applications and be a part of an exciting expansion of pharmacy services for our patients. We have a diverse team of analysts and clinical pharmacists who support technology solutions for the pharmacy at our institution.

The areas of Outpatient and Specialty Pharmacy are rapidly growing, and our team is playing a significant role in installing, supporting, and optimizing pharmacy systems to support patient care activities. The analyst will partner closely with pharmacists, providers, operational leaders, and technology teams to support medication-use workflows, medication safety initiatives, regulatory requirements, and optimization of pharmacy technology solutions across ambulatory and specialty pharmacy environments.

Responsibilities*

 
  • Plan, implement and maintain Outpatient and Specialty Pharmacy operational and clinical applications to meet department needs
  • Investigate, troubleshoot, and resolve application, workflow, and data issues impacting medication-use systems and pharmacy operations
  • Perform application testing, validation, and change control activities to ensure clinical accuracy, patient safety, and system integrity
  • Participate in multidisciplinary workgroups and committees to ensure electronic health records are compliant with current practices, guidelines, and regulatory standards
  • Support medication safety and quality initiatives with a focus on supporting ambulatory and specialty pharmacy workflows including e-prescribing, refill management, medication access, and prior authorization processes
  • Work with third party vendors to integrate key data into Epic Willow build
  • Manage projects (upgrades, new implementations) as needed

Required Qualifications*

 
  • Licensure in good standing, or immediate eligibility for licensure, as a registered pharmacist in the state of Michigan. 
  • Doctor of pharmacy degree or Master and/or Bachelor of Science degree in Pharmacy with one-year residency or equivalent clinical experience.
  • Foundational knowledge of pharmacy workflows, medication safety principles and EMR systems
  • Exposure to IT project management principles

Desired Qualifications*

 
  • Completion of PGY2 Pharmacy Informatics Residency
  • Experience implementing IT healthcare solutions
  • Experience supporting Epic Willow Ambulatory, Compass Rose and Clarity or similar specialty pharmacy integrated platforms
  • Familiarity with URAC, ACHC, and health-system specialty pharmacy accreditation requirements
  • Familiarity with HIPAA and other healthcare information regulations and requirements
